I'd recommend that you get an external USB hard drive enclosure that uses IDE (EIDE). That will allow you to access all your data as before and you can continue to use the drive for backup/redundancy/expansion as required.
You may need to adjust the jumper settings on the hard drive. See the instructions usually on the hard drive label to set the device to master or cable select.
